Our real estate department handles commercial real estate transactions, including contract negotiations, zoning and land use and land development, providing legal representation for complex real estate issues. In addition to commercial real estate and business transfers, our attorneys handle routine transfers and like-kind exchanges under §1031.

Attorneys' fees for real estate matters are based on individual client needs. Hourly billing, flat fee, and percentage fees are common, depending upon the nature of the work.
